== Cebuano ==
=== Etymology ===
Borrowed from Spanish ganancia.
=== Pronunciation ===
IPA(key): /ɡaˌnansiˈa/ [ɡɐˌn̪an̪ˈs̪ja]
Hyphenation: ga‧nan‧si‧ya
=== Noun ===
ganánsiyá (Badlit spelling ᜄᜈᜈ᜔ᜐᜒᜌ)
profit
(slang, humorous) one's offspring
=== Verb ===
ganánsiyá (Badlit spelling ᜄᜈᜈ᜔ᜐᜒᜌ)
to profit
to have an advantage over something or someone

== Tagalog ==
=== Alternative forms ===
ganansya, ginansya, superseded, pre-2007
ginansiya
=== Etymology ===
Borrowed from Spanish ganancia.
=== Pronunciation ===
(Standard Tagalog) IPA(key): /ɡaˈnansia/ [ɡɐˈn̪an̪.ʃɐ]
IPA(key): (no palatal assimilation) /ɡaˈnansia/ [ɡɐˈn̪an̪.sjɐ]
Rhymes: -ansia
Syllabification: ga‧nan‧si‧ya
=== Noun ===
ganánsiyá (Baybayin spelling ᜄᜈᜈ᜔ᜐᜒᜌ)
profit; gain
Synonyms: tubo, kita, pakinabang
benefit; reward
Synonyms: pakinabang, pala, gantimpala
